CAREER NOTES
First on SDSU’s career saves list (269)... Second on SDSU’s career goals against average list (1.00)... First on SDSU’s career wins list (30)... First on SDSU’s career ties list (7)... First on SDSU’s career shutout list (20)... Second on SDSU’s save percent list (.835).. First on SDSU’s minutes played list for a goalie (5,058) ....
2008
Started all 21 games for the Jacks while recording 10 shutouts and finishing with a 15-5-1 record ... finished with 92 saves and a 0.76 goals against average with a save percentage of .852 ... was named to the First Team All-Summit League ... set the SDSU record for minutes played in a season (1,906) ... named Summit League Defensive Player of the Week on Sept 2 ... Summit League Women's Athlete of the Month in November by leading the Jacks with a shutout over Oakland (Mich.) in the Summit League Championship and a shutout against Colorado in the first round of the NCAA Tournament ... had a season high 14 saves in a 2-0 loss to Minnesota (8/26) ... won 10 straight starts from Sept. 14 to Oct. 20 ... did not allow a goal from Sept. 26 to Oct. 20 while having 27 saves in a row without allowing a goal ... shutout Colorado in the first round of the NCAA Tournament recording 10 saves in a 1-0 win (11/14)
2007
Started 12 of the 13 games she appeared in... Recorded her first shutout of the season against conference foe Oakland (9/7) in a 3-0 victory... Against Weber State (9/21), tallied career highs in saves (15) and shots faced (33) in a 2-2 tie... Ended the season with a career best four shutouts in a row against Centenary (10/26), Oral Roberts (10/28), Liberty (11/2) and Longwood (11/4)... For her efforts Lograsso received The Summit League Defensive Player of the Week honors for Nov. 5.

2006
Started 10 of the 15 games she saw action in... Posted a 4-5-2 record with six shutouts... Lost her first four starts before posting a 4-1-1 record in the final seven games of the season... Earned her first complete-game shutout against Texas Tech (10/6) making a single-game career-high 14 saves in a double-overtime 0-0 game... Was selected to the United Soccer Conference all-tournament team after working over 249 minutes of shutout soccer including 45 minutes in an 8-0 win over Howard (11/2), a 0-0 tie against Utah Valley State (11/3), and a 1-0 win against North Dakota State (11/5) in the championship game.
USC Defensive Player of the Week after recording her second complete-game shutout of the season... Won a 3-0 game against United Soccer Conference foe IPFW (10/13) to garner her first victory of the season.
2005
Made eight starts in goal and played in 10 total games, recording just over 857 minutes of work for the Jacks during her freshman campaign... allowed 17 goals with a 1.79 goals-against average while making 47 saves... Allowed no goals in each of her relief appearances against College of St. Mary (10/8) and Utah Valley State (10/20)... Made a single-game season-best eight saves against Northern Colorado... Earned her first collegiate win in the season-opener at home against Minnesota State (8/26), allowing just one goal... Posted a 4-5-0 record on the season.
BEFORE SDSU
Earned second-team all-conference honors at Ames High School after recording four shutouts in her senior season... Was a member of the Iowa Olympic Development Program... Played on seven state championship teams at the club level with Urbandale Premier and Ankeny Premier squads in the Des Moines area.
